Georgian architecture continues to influence the design of many of the UK’s most successful contemporary homes, and for good reason.
Its enduring appeal lies in proportion rather than decoration. Symmetrical façades, balanced window arrangements and restrained detailing create homes that feel composed and timeless without relying on passing trends.
A contemporary interpretation doesn’t mean replicating an eighteenth-century house. Instead, it takes the principles that made Georgian architecture successful and adapts them for modern living. Larger openings, open-plan spaces, improved energy performance and stronger connections to the landscape can all be incorporated while retaining the order and simplicity that define the style.
The result is a home that feels familiar, yet entirely suited to the way we live today. It respects architectural tradition without being constrained by it.
The best contemporary Georgian homes aren’t copies of the past. They are informed by it.
